#stepper-motor #motor #driver #stepper #serial-communication #trinamic

tmc2209

A driver implementation for the TMC2209 stepper motor driver by Trinamic

4 releases

0.2.2 Jul 1, 2021
0.2.1 Jun 30, 2021
0.2.0 Feb 5, 2021
0.1.0 Jul 12, 2020

#598 in Hardware support

Download history 43/week @ 2024-07-20 60/week @ 2024-07-27 45/week @ 2024-08-03 24/week @ 2024-08-10 20/week @ 2024-08-17 1/week @ 2024-08-24 6/week @ 2024-08-31 11/week @ 2024-09-14 28/week @ 2024-09-21 31/week @ 2024-09-28 7/week @ 2024-10-05 8/week @ 2024-10-12 24/week @ 2024-10-19 76/week @ 2024-10-26 11/week @ 2024-11-02

120 downloads per month
Used in 2 crates

MIT/Apache

49KB
1K SLoC

tmc2209 Actions Status Crates.io Crates.io docs.rs

A driver implementation for the TMC2209 stepper motor driver by Trinamic.

The implementation is focused on exposing the UART interface in a friendly manner, suitable for both blocking and non-blocking serial communication.

Dependencies

~115–465KB